Intersection of column 9 with block 9. The value <5> only appears in one or more of squares R7C9, R8C9 and R9C9 of column 9. These squares are the ones that intersect with block 9. Thus, the other (non-intersecting) squares of block 9 cannot contain this value.

Squares R1C1 and R1C9 in row 1 and R5C1 and R5C9 in row 5 form a Simple X-Wing pattern on possibility <7>. All other instances of this possibility in columns 1 and 9 can be removed.

Squares R3C3, R7C3 and R8C3 in column 3, R3C5 and R7C5 in column 5 and R7C8 and R8C8 in column 8 form a Swordfish pattern on possibility <3>. All other instances of this possibility in rows 3, 7 and 8 can be removed.

Squares R1C1 (XY), R3C3 (XZ) and R5C1 (YZ) form an XY-Wing pattern on <1>. All squares that are buddies of both the XZ and YZ squares cannot be <1>.
